About Jiaping Zhang

Jiaping Zhang is a scholar working on Ceramics and Composites, Mechanical Engineering and Materials Chemistry, having authored 84 papers that have together received 2.0k indexed citations. Recurring topics across this work include Advanced ceramic materials synthesis (60 papers), Advanced materials and composites (44 papers) and Diamond and Carbon-based Materials Research (26 papers). The work is most often cited by research in Ceramics and Composites (1.6k citations), Mechanical Engineering (1.3k citations) and Materials Chemistry (1.2k citations). Jiaping Zhang has collaborated with scholars based in China, Japan and Austria. Frequent co-authors include Qiangang Fu, Hejun Li, Lei Zhuang, Junling Qu, Mingde Tong, Lei Zhou, Dou Hu, Pei Zhang, Qiangang Fu and Yasuo Gotoh. Their work appears in journals such as SHILAP Revista de lepidopterología, Langmuir and Carbon.
